My hair is very dry and I'm looking for shampoo and conditioner that has intense moisture. This needs to be available at Wal-Mart, I cannot afford the salon stuff. I once or twice a week straight iron my hair. I've stopped washing it daily hoping that would help a little, sadly it hasn't. Any one out there know of a good store bought product that will help?

as a hair stylist, i don't recommend using walmart stuff, but when that's what's in the budget you have to make the best. go for the tresseme line of products. look for anything that is for dry hair or to add moisture. tresseme started out in a salon years ago, then went to over the counter. whatever you do stay away from pantene. it has wax in it and will over time leave, a wax residue on you hair. don't stop washing your hair, it will just end up greasy. also try getting a heat protector or thermal spray for your hair if you are going to use the straight iron. if none of this works you might consider trying the salon stuff. i know it gets pricey, but it really does work. Paul Mitchell's intense moisture line does amazing thing for dry hair. just remember whether it walmart or salon, nothing works over night.....it's gonna take time no matter what you use. hope this helps.

Use a moisture shampoo %26amp; a moisture conditioner every time you shampoo.Get a moisture leave in conditioner. Get a heavy rescontruter and condition at least once ever 2 weeks. Get your hair trimmed about every 6 to 8 weeks. Make sure when you use your stright iron your hair is completely dry. If it is not you are drying your hair that way and breaking it down. Salon products can be expensive but they last a long time and well worth the money. Most people use way too much for a single application.

This might sound a little odd at first, but if you are serious about helping your hair try this. Take 1 part conditioner, the cheaper stuff like Suave and VO5 actually works better, btw. 1/4 part clear aloe gel, not the colored stuff used to treat sunburns, and 1/4 part honey. Mix this all together and put it in the microwave for no more than 10 seconds. Slap this on your dry hair, cover with cap or plastic bag, and rinse it out half an hour later. This is called Snowy's Moisture Treatment. I found it on a hair forum, and it has done wonders for me. Don't be afraid of putting honey on your hair, it will NOT make it sticky, but make it soft and easier to manage.

wash ur hair towel dry put conditioner on ur hair pretty thick put a shower cap on ur head (1.00) at walmart leave this on head for a couple of hours. the heat from ur head is fine or put a hairdryer to the cap for a few minutes. rinse ur hair as normal and ur ready to go. do this as often as u like it will improve the health of ur hair. i straighten my hair everyday and this keeps it soft and healthy. goood luck.
